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- /*
- * Tercera Tarea: Ejercicios - Ordenamiento y busqueda
- * Pregunta 7 - Ordenamiento por intercalacion
- *
- * Archivo: main.cpp
- * Federico Jhoel Salas Gonzalez 201244557
- * IC2001 - Estructura de Datos - Grupo 1
- * Profesor Armando Arce
- * Ingenieria en Computacion
- * Escuela de Computacion
- * Instituto Tecnologico de Costa Rica
- *
- * Descripcion del programa
- *
- * Este porgrama prueba la funcion ordMergeIterativo. Se crea un
- * arreglo de strings desordenado, se imprime, se ordena y se vuelve
- * a imprimir ya ordenado.
- */
- #include <iostream>
- #include "mergesort_iterativo.h"
- int main(){
- // Arreglo ejemplo
- std::string ejemplo[] = {
- "BOHICA",
- "TARFU",
- "FUBAR",
- "SNAFU",
- "SUSFU",
- "John Doe",
- "Richard Roe",
- "Joe Black",
- "John Smith",
- "John Q. Public"
- };
- // Imprimir arreglo original
- std::cout << "Arreglo original:\n";
- for(int i = 0; i < 10; i++){
- std::cout << "'" << ejemplo[i] << "'";
- if (i < 9){
- std::cout << ", ";
- }
- }
- ordMergeIterativo(ejemplo, 10);
- // Imprimir arreglo ordenado
- std::cout << "\n\nArreglo ordenado:\n";
- for(int i = 0; i < 10; i++){
- std::cout << "'" << ejemplo[i] << "'";
- if (i < 9){
- std::cout << ", ";
- }
- }
- return 0;
- }
Add Comment
Please, Sign In to add comment